Description & Specs

The AS is a semi-acoustic guitar built to tackle just about any genre of music you throw at it. The pickups are mounted directly to the center block for increased sustain and feedback elimination.

Ibanez first introduced Artcore back in 2002 and it has remained a workhorse hollow-body guitar for musicians all over the world ever since. The Artcore's combination of quality workmanship and affordability has created legions of devoted fans from diverse genres as blues, country, rock and jazz. Artcore offers musicians the purity of an old school jazz-box or a hybrid semi-hollow rocker. The line is highly respected for its tone, sustain and, expressive playability.

Color: Prussian Blue Metallic
Series: AS
Number of Strings: 6
Neck Type: AS Artcore
Neck Joint: Set-in
Neck Material: Nyatoh
Neck finish: Gloss Polyurethane
Neck thickness (1st fret, mm): 21
Nut width (mm): 43
Number of frets: 22
Fretboard: Bound Walnut
Fretboard Radius (mm): 305
Fret Type: Medium
Inlay: Acrylic block
Body Top material (For Solid): Linden
Body Sides Material (For Acoustic/Hollow): Linden
Body Back material (For Acoustic/Hollow): Linden
Body finish: Gloss Polyurethane
Bridge: Gibraltar Performer
String spacing (mm): 10.5
Tailpiece: Quik Change III
Nut: Plastic
Machine Head: Ibanez machine heads
Hardware color: Gold
Neck Pickup: Classic Elite (H)
Bridge Pickup: Classic Elite (H)
Pickup Configuration: HH
Controls, Pickup selector: 2 Volume, 2 Tone, 3-way toggle switch
